The cost of lead paint testing varies based on several factors, including the size of the property, the number of areas tested, and the chosen testing method. Laboratory analysis offers detailed results but typically incurs higher fees, especially when multiple samples are involved. On-site testing provides quicker results and may be suitable for preliminary assessments, often at a lower cost. Additional charges may apply for testing in hard-to-access areas or properties located in remote regions. An accurate estimate considers these variables and the scope of the inspection required.
